Dejero and RGB Spectrum Partner to Combine Real-Time Visualization and Resilient Connectivity for Mobile TOCs

Companies Unite to Showcase New IPX Flyaway Kit at AFCEA West 2025


Dejero, a leader in resilient connectivity solutions, and RGB Spectrum, a pioneer in mission-critical, real-time video solutions, are set to announce their new partnership at AFCEA West 2025. The companies will unveil their latest innovation, the IPX Flyaway Kit, a command centerโ€™s display and connectivity infrastructure in a box, at booth #753 from January 28-30 at the San Diego Convention Center.

This partnership combines Dejero’s cutting-edge connectivity technologyโ€”aggregating the bandwidth of multiple network providers, including 4G, LTE-A, 5G, fiber, IP connections, and LEO, MEO, and GEO satellitesโ€”to deliver enhanced reliability, expanded coverage, and greater bandwidth for connecting mobile workforces and remote locations to command centers.

Paired with RGB Spectrum’s advanced visualization solutions, this collaboration empowers government, civilian, and military agencies with a mobile solution for unparalleled situational awareness and operational control.

At the forefront of this partnership is the IPX Flyaway Kit, a deployable, miniaturized command-and-control solution designed for real-time video distribution, visualization, and decision-making in the most demanding environments.

Introducing the IPX Flyaway Kit

The IPX Flyaway Kit offers a portable solution that integrates:

– Dejeroโ€™s Smart Blending Technologyโ„ข, which aggregates multiple network connections (4G, 5G, satellite, fiber, etc.) for ultra-reliable, high-bandwidth connectivity.

– RGB Spectrumโ€™s Zioยฎ Video-over-IP platform, providing real-time, low-latency video processing, encoding, decoding, and seamless distribution to remote displays, video walls, and mobile devices.

The result is a powerful, compact control room solution that enhances situational awareness and streamlines decision-making for defense, public safety, and emergency response agencies.

About Dejero
Dejero provides real-time video and networking solutions that deliver resilient, uninterrupted connectivity for critical communications. By aggregating diverse telecommunication networks, Dejero enables enhanced reliability, expanded coverage, and greater bandwidth for its global customers. Founded in 2008, Dejero is headquartered in Waterloo, Ontario, Canada. For more information, visit www.dejero.com.

About RGB Spectrum
RGB Spectrum is a leading designer and manufacturer of real-time video solutions for mission-critical applications. Specializing in visualization and control systems, RGB Spectrum serves civilian, government, and military clients worldwide. Learn more about RGB Spectrumโ€™s innovative solutions at www.rgb.com.
